Amazon CloudFront vs Azure Front Door

A comparison of Amazon CloudFront and Azure Front Door built from values read directly from each provider's own documentation, with the source recorded against every figure.

The short answer

Pick Amazon CloudFront if
Teams already on AWS that want CDN bundled with other AWS services under one flat monthly price rather than itemized per-GB billing.
Pick Azure Front Door if
Teams on Azure that want CDN, global load balancing and WAF as one combined entry point rather than separate products.

3 sourced criteria separate them:

Free tier
Amazon CloudFront: Yes
Azure Front Door: No
Entry paid plan
Amazon CloudFront: Pro plan: $15/month.
Azure Front Door: Standard tier: $35/month base fee. Premium tier: $330/month base fee.
Pricing model
Amazon CloudFront: Flat-rate monthly plans bundling CloudFront with multiple AWS services and features, with no overage charges within plan limits.
Azure Front Door: Multi-dimensional: an hourly base fee, outbound data transfer to clients, outbound transfer to origins, and per-request fees.

Consider something else if…

  • Amazon CloudFront: Traffic profile is unusual or very high volume — the flat-rate plans bundle a fixed allowance, and a metered pay-as-you-go CDN may price better outside that shape.
  • Azure Front Door: Budget-sensitive at small scale — no free tier and a $35/month base fee before any traffic is a higher floor than most pay-as-you-go CDNs in this category.

Documented by only one.

These criteria are published by one provider and not the other. An absence here means we have not found a source, not that the feature is missing.

Egress over allowanceAzure Front Door: North America (Zone 1): $0.083/GB for the first 10 TB/month, with tiered reductions at higher volumes.
Points of presenceAmazon CloudFront: Hundreds of edge locations (exact count not published on the pricing page).
